Angular 個人深究(四)【生命周期鈎子】 定義: 每個組件都有一個被 Angular 管理的生命周期。 Angular 創建它,渲染它,創建並渲染它的子組件,在它被綁定的屬性發生變化時檢查它,並在它從 DOM 中被移除前銷毀它。 Angular 提供了生命周期鈎子,把這些關鍵生命時刻 ...
生命周期鈎子詳解 構造函數 constructor是ES 中class中新增的屬性,當class類實例化的時候調用constructor,來初始化類。Angular中的組件就是基於class類實現的,在Angular中,constructor用於注入依賴。 組件的構造函數會在所有的生命周期鈎子之前被調用,它主要用於依賴注入或執行簡單的數據初始化操作。 import Component, Elem ...
2020-09-14 08:22 0 693 推薦指數:
Angular 個人深究(四)【生命周期鈎子】 定義: 每個組件都有一個被 Angular 管理的生命周期。 Angular 創建它,渲染它,創建並渲染它的子組件,在它被綁定的屬性發生變化時檢查它,並在它從 DOM 中被移除前銷毀它。 Angular 提供了生命周期鈎子,把這些關鍵生命時刻 ...
angular 生命周期鈎子的詳細介紹在 https://angular.cn/guide/lifecycle-hooks 文檔中做了介紹。 ngOnInit() 在 Angular 第一次顯示數據綁定和設置指令/組件的輸入屬性之后,初始化指令/組件; ngAfterViewInit ...
簡介 Angular 指令的生命周期,它是用來記錄指令從創建、應用及銷毀的過程。Angular 提供了一系列與指令生命周期相關的鈎子,便於我們監控指令生命周期的變化,並執行相關的操作。Angular 中所有的鈎子如下圖所示: 分類 指令與組件共有的鈎子 ...
生命周期執行順序ngOnChanges 在有輸入屬性的情況下才會調用,該方法接受當前和上一屬性值的SimpleChanges對象。如果有輸入屬性,會在ngOnInit之前調用。 ngOnInit 在組件初始化的時候調用,只調用一次,在第一次調用ngOnChanges之后調用 ...
https://cn.vuejs.org/v2/guide/instance.html#%E5%AE%9E%E4%BE%8B%E7%94%9 ...
Vue實例有一個完整的生命周期,也就是從開始創建、初始化數據、編譯模板、掛載Dom、渲染→更新→渲染、卸載等一系列過程,我們稱這是Vue的生命周期。通俗說就是Vue實例從創建到銷毀的過程,就是生命周期。 created:html加載完成之前,執行。執行順序:父組件-子組件 mounted ...
什么是生命周期 生命周期函數通俗的講就是組件創建、組件更新、組件銷毀的時候會觸發的一系列的方法。 當 Angular 使用構造函數新建一個組件或指令后,就會按下面的順序在特定時刻調用這些 生命周期鈎子方法。 每個接口都有唯一的一個鈎子方法,它們的名字是由接口名再加上ng前綴構成 ...
在AngularJS應用起動前,它們以HTML文本的形式保存在文本編輯器中。應用啟動后會進行編譯和鏈接,作用域會同HTML進行綁定,應用可以對用戶在HTML中進行的操作進行實時響應。這個神器的效果是如何發生的?創建高效率的應用需要了解什么? 在這個過程中總共有兩個主要階段。 第一個階段 ...